Bitcoin Breaks $70K: Polymarket Sees $65K the Next Stop?
Bitcoin slid below $70,000, down over 6% intraday, marking its lowest level since Trump took office. From the $126,000 peak last October, Bitcoin is now down more than 40%. Prediction markets are turning increasingly bearish: Polymarket shows an 82% probability of BTC falling below $65,000 this year, with odds of a drop under $55,000 rising to nearly 60%. ETF outflows, tightening liquidity, and risk-off sentiment are amplifying downside pressure. How do you view? Would BTC head to $65k? Sell or add?
